public virtual CrystalDecisions.CrystalReports.Engine.ReportDocument CreateReport() { LetterOfRequestTOR rpt = new LetterOfRequestTOR(); rpt.Site = this.Site; return(rpt); }
public void loadLetterOfRequest(List<Customer> selectedStudents, String schName, String schAdd, String attained, String schYear) { LetterOfRequestTOR rpt = new LetterOfRequestTOR(); DataSetStudents ds = new DataSetStudents(); foreach (Customer c in selectedStudents) { DataRow cRow = ds.Student.NewRow(); cRow["CustomerID"] = c.CustomerID; cRow["CustomerName"] = c.CustomerName; cRow["FirstName"] = c.FirstName; cRow["LastName"] = c.LastName; cRow["Gender"] = c.Gender; cRow["EmailAddress"] = c.EmailAddress; cRow["Level"] = c.Level; cRow["Section"] = c.Section; ds.Student.Rows.Add(cRow); } rpt.DataDefinition.FormulaFields["schoolName"].Text = "\"" + schName+"\""; rpt.DataDefinition.FormulaFields["schoolAddress"].Text = "\"" + schAdd + "\""; rpt.DataDefinition.FormulaFields["attainment"].Text = "\"" + attained + "\""; rpt.DataDefinition.FormulaFields["schoolYear"].Text = "\"" + schYear + "\""; rpt.SetDataSource(ds); crystalReportViewer1.ReportSource = rpt; crystalReportViewer1.Refresh(); }
public virtual CrystalDecisions.CrystalReports.Engine.ReportDocument CreateReport() { LetterOfRequestTOR rpt = new LetterOfRequestTOR(); rpt.Site = this.Site; return rpt; }